With a spike in visiting travelers, the short-term lodging sector must vigilantly consider the fresh legislation dubbed the Airbnb Statute. The legislation is meant to establish harsher rules for quick-term vacation lets, demanding the owners satisfy authorization standards. While this might affect the adaptability and earnings potential of rental accommodations, it also ensures a more regulated and secure milieu for both residential and lodgers. Complying with these guidelines is vital for landlords aiming to profit from the flourishing tourism sector while also safeguarding against the repercussions of non-adherence.

Residential zones in idyllic spots such as Tulum, Mazatlán, and Puerto Vallarta are booming. Many places give chances to invest money, and Tulum is especially important this year because it has grown in value by 6.2%. This escalation underscores the versatile characteristic of the property market within the area, making it an alluring pick for shrewd financiers aiming to profit from the nation's thriving economy.
